Launched in 2009 by 18-year-old Leif K-Brooks, the service paired random strangers for one-on-one text and video conversations. At its peak during the COVID-19 pandemic, it saw over 65 million monthly visits . However, the site’s refusal to implement strict age verification or registration eventually made it a hub for exploitation, leading to its closure amid mounting legal pressure and psychological stress on its founder. The platform's attempts at moderation were arguably too little, too late. Features like "Dorm Chat" (for college students) and "Spy Mode" (where one user asks a question and two others discuss it) tried to steer the ship toward civility. The implementation of "Moderated Section" and AI image recognition tools attempted to scrub the feeds of explicit content, but the sheer volume of users made effective policing impossible. Furthermore, the existence of an "Unmoderated Section" was widely criticized as a concession to the very behavior that plagued the site.
